Rum Raisin Cake (corky)

Ingrients & Directions


2 lg -or 3 midium,Ripe bananas
1 1/2 c Sugar
3 Eggs
2 ts Baking powder
1 ts Salt
1 c Dark rum
1 c Walnuts,coarsely chopped
1/2 c Oil
2 1/2 c All-purpose flour
1 ts Baking soda
1 ts Allspice
1 c Raisins

Peel bananas and beat in mixer until liquified. Add sugar, eggs, oil
and rum, beat until well combined. Combine flour, baking powder,
soda, salt and allspice. Beat flour mixture into banana mixture until
blended. Stir in raisins and walnuts. Pour into 10-inch greased or
sprayed fluted tube pan. Bake in 350’F. oven for 50 to 60 minutes or
until cake tests done. Cool in pan for 10 minutes, then invert on
wire rack to cool completly. Dust with confectioner’s sugar if
desired.

Yields
24 Servings
